Explanation:

We need to solve the equation:


\sqrt{50y^(12)}

We know 50 = 2*5*5

2*5*5 can be written as: 2* 5^2

and √ = 1/2

Solving:


=\sqrt{2*5*5*y^(12)}\\= \sqrt{2*5^2*y^(12)}\\=(2)^(1/2)*(5^2)^(1/2)*y^(12)^(1/2)\\=(2)^(1/2)*5*y^6\\=5y^6 √(2)

So, the answer is:
5y^6 √(2)
